We all grew up with the four basic tastes: sweet, sour, bitter, salty. But there is a fifth taste, umame, that translates as “savory” or “flavorful”. It’s that rich, deeply satisfying, sensual taste. Think gravy, steak, brie cheese, truffles, parmesan – that’s umame.
Humans instinctively seek it out, which is why we tend to crave chocolate cake instead of an apple.
Japanese researchers identified umame a century ago, and thank goodness they’re finally sharing it with the world.
